Bug description:  ext/tokenizer 's example should be fixed

Description:
------------
In HEAD -> 5.0.0-dev T_ML_COMMENT is not defined as constant. When
error_reporting is E_ALL, many notices are generated.
In 5.0 both "//" and "/* */" are resolved as T_COMMENT (int)361
